Abstract (EN)

The purpose of this study is to determine the vocabulary sets in Turkish written expression of Syrian secondary schools students and to reveal the factors that affect their vocabulary sets. This study adopts qualitative research methods. The study group consists of 41 students studying in the districts of Kepez and Muratpaşa, Antalya. The demographic information form and composition paper are used to collect the data.The data are collected from the students in one sitting. The collected data are analysed through descriptive analysis technique. As a result of the analysis, it has been revealed that the students' total, different and active vocabulary usage changes according to the schools and the grades. The increase in the grades doesn't correspond with the increase in vocabulary in the study. The students in 6th grade have the highest, and the ones in 8th grade have the lowest vocabulary sets in this study. There isn't a big difference among students in terms of using different and active vocabulary. That shows that the students know almost the same words in terms of word type. Considering the frequency of the vocabulary used by the students, it is observed that they maintain the writing activities with insufficient number of vocabulary. Besides, it was revealed that Syrian students do not use the vocabulary they should use frequently in Turkish. In the study, the students whose parents' education level is higher have generally better vocabulary sets than the other students and the parents' socio economic level doesn't affect their vocabulary sets. The students with low socio-economic level have the highest average of vocabulary sets. It is revealed that the gender variable affects students' vocabulary sets. It is also observed that the female students have considerably higher vocabulary sets than the male students. The result "The longer the students live in Turkey, the higher vocabulary sets they will have" is among the research results. There is a relationship between students' duration of stay in Turkey and their vocabulary sets. Nevertheless, the vocabulary set averages of the students who never attended the school in Turkey reverse this case. In conclusion, it is observed that Syrian students don't have sufficient vocabulary level in Turkish written expression. Besides, it is revealed that the students' vocabulary sets are affected from their gender, the duration of stay and education in Turkey. Keywords: Syrian students, Writing skills, Vocabulary Set.
